Come and enjoy a favorite Brown County cabin! All newly renovated and redesigned, Homestead Cabin is a full blend of new convenience and old time charm! The great room contains a wonderful view of the gorgeous lake.

Just 6 ½ miles from Nashville, where you will find all that this little town has to offer is the Homestead Cabin, Just opening April 2021. This cabin is on a very small dead end county road and not a lot of traffic.

Enjoy the front deck furniture in the evening, sipping your favorite drink. Relish your coffee and the early morning from this covered private front porch. Or unwind, watching the stars from the small dock at the lake.

Inside, there is an open concept of the living room and the dining room and kitchen. They have totally remodeled and added an island with a dishwasher and man what a view! Doing dishes has never had such a great view overlooking the lake. The wall of windows in the living room will make you never want to leave this property. At this time, the corner wood stove is OFF LIMITS and for looks only and will most likely be replaced soon.

You and yours will retreat to your queen bed perhaps or your little ones or guests will retreat to the trundle bed in the nook. In the morning, enjoy the enormous shower and the ample space.

    Overall was a great little cabin. Daughter is a student at IU and this was an inexpensive alternate to hotel rooms that were thru the roof for the weekend. Its a bit of a drive down crooked rural roads, but a beautiful part of the country. Would be great access to Nashville. Peaceful and remote, but the check in process is a bit onerous. You have to go to the Property Manager office to pick up the key and drop it back off, but it is 5 miles in the wrong direction from the cabin, so adds at least 20 minutes to the drive from Bloomington on check in/out day. Also, they have written directions on a small map to find the place. Made me feel like a pirate with a buried treasure map. Less than ideal when it is dark out and you are tired trying to find street signs at 55 mph. Give a GPS coordinate, at least, or an address. I ended up dropping a pin to navigate to/from once I got there, made it 10x easier. No wifi, but Verizon had great service. Put in a Starlink, and make the front door a Bluetooth code, eliminate the keys, and it would be perfect. The place was super clean, the little pond was beautiful, the bathroom was modern, kitchen would be great. Despite the key process, I will book here again, because its worth it.
